在数字货币的世界里,比特币作为一种去中心化的虚拟货币,已经获得了全球数百万用户的青睐。而比特币钱包则是保存、管理比特币的重要工具,它允许用户进行交易、查看余额以及生成新的钱包地址。然而,很多用户在使用比特币钱包的过程中,可能会遇到无法生成钱包地址的尴尬问题。本文将深入探讨这种问题的原因以及相应的解决方案,以帮助用户更顺畅地使用比特币钱包。

比特币钱包地址生成的基本原理

要理解比特币钱包地址无法生成的原因,首先需要了解比特币钱包地址的生成原理。每个比特币钱包都有一个唯一的地址,这个地址是由一对公钥和私钥生成的。首先,用户创建一个钱包时,会生成一组密钥对,其中私钥用于签名交易,确保只有钱包的持有者能够使用其比特币,而公钥则可以生成钱包地址。

然后,这个公钥经过散列函数处理后,生成哈希值,最终生成比特币地址。比特币地址主要有两种类型:P2PKH(以“1”开头)和P2SH(以“3”开头)。每个地址都代表着一个特定的比特币交易账户,用户可以收发比特币。

无法生成比特币钱包地址的常见原因

比特币钱包地址无法生成的问题,可能由多种原因造成,以下是一些常见原因:

1. 软件故障或更新问题

用户使用的比特币钱包软件可能遇到程序bug,或者需要更新到最新版本。大多数软件开发者会定期发布更新,修复之前版本中存在的缺陷。用户若不及时更新,就可能导致软件功能无法正常运行,进而影响到钱包地址的生成。

2. 硬件故障

如果用户在手机或计算机上使用比特币钱包,而设备的硬件出故障,如损坏的存储设备、过热或电源不稳定,都可能影响软件的正常运行。特别是在处理复杂计算时,如果设备性能不足,也可能导致生成钱包地址失败。

3. 网络连接不稳定

比特币钱包在生成地址或进行交易时,通常需要与区块链网络建立连接。如果网络不稳定、信号差或断网,可能会导致软件无法连接到区块链,进而妨碍钱包地址的生成。这对于依赖在线服务的钱包尤其明显。

4. 用户输入错误

用户在移动端或桌面上输入信息时可能发生错误,例如输入密码时的拼写错误或随机输入的字符不适配这款钱包的要求。这种情况下,软件会显示错误信息,提示用户无法生成钱包地址。

解决比特币钱包地址无法生成的有效方法

了解了无法生成比特币钱包地址的原因后,下面提供一些有效的解决方案。用户在遇到问题时,可以通过以下方法尝试解决:

1. 更新钱包软件

首先,及时更新比特币钱包软件是一个有效的解决方法。不同钱包的软件界面和功能都有差异,但一般都可以在软件的设置或关于页面找到更新选项。用户只需按照提示更新到最新的版本,便可以修复由于软件故障导致的问题。

2. 检查硬件状态

用户可检查计算机或手机的硬件状态,确保设备正常工作。例如,检查存储空间是否充足、CPU是否过载,或者手机是否因为过热影响运行。若发现硬件异常,应考虑进行硬件维修或更换。

3. 确保网络连接稳定

在使用比特币钱包时,确保安全且快速的网络连接至关重要。用户应该选择信号强劲、稳定的网络,必要时可以尝试重启路由器或更换网络环境。此外,使用移动数据更新可能会更加流畅。

4. 验证用户输入

用户在填入信息时,建议仔细检查每个输入项,尤其是密码和其他敏感信息。许多钱包会提供密码可见选项,用户可以使用此功能检查输入是否正确。此外,用户可以在其他受信任的设备上尝试生成地址,以确认问题是否出在本设备上。

常见问题解答

1. 为什么使用不同的钱包软件会影响地址生成

不同的钱包软件在实现比特币地址生成的方式上有所不同,部分软件可能有不同的算法、数据结构或功能实现。因此,某些软件可能在生成新地址时效率高、稳定性好,而另一些软件则可能存在BUG或不具备最新特性。当用户使用不兼容或老旧的钱包软件时,可能会导致无法生成新的比特币地址。更新软件或尝试其他钱包都是有效的解决策略。

2. 生成地址的过程中是否有信息泄露的风险

在生成比特币钱包地址的过程中,通常不会泄露用户的隐私信息,因为比特币的设计理念就是去中心化且匿名。然而,如果用户在使用过程中与不安全的网络连接进行交互,存在数据被攻击者截获的风险。因此,用户需确保在创建及使用钱包地址时,使用的是安全的网络环境。

3. 如何备份我的比特币钱包以防意外丢失地址

由于比特币钱包是去中心化的,用户最佳的做法是经常备份其钱包数据。常用的备份方法包括导出私钥和公钥、创建助记词或使用软件提供的备份功能。用户可将备份文件存储在外部设备或安全的云存储上。此外,用户同样需要定期进行备份,以确保数据的时效性与安全性。

4. 是否可以通过在线服务生成比特币地址

目前,网上存在许多平台和工具可以帮助用户创建比特币钱包地址。然而,用户需谨慎选择,因为不可靠的在线服务可能存在安全隐患,用户的私钥和其它敏感信息可能会被窃取。尽量选择知名的、评价良好的平台,确保使用过程中的信息安全。

总结来说,比特币钱包地址的生成可能因多种原因受到影响,如软件故障、硬件问题或网络环境不佳等。用户在面临无法生成比特币钱包地址的情况下,应首先进行排查,并使用相应的解决方案。此外,时刻保持警惕和关注隐私信息的安全性,将有助于用户更好地管理自己的比特币钱包。